Use the sign test to see if there is a difference between the number of days until collection of an account receivable before and after a new collection policy. Use the 0.05 significance level.
Solution
Before: 30 28 34 35 40 42 33 38 34 45 28 27 25 41 36
After: 32 29 33 32 37 43 40 41 37 44 27 33 30 38 36
(1st - 2nd)Calculated - - + + + - - - + + - - + 0
The number of plus and minus signs for each pair is shown along with the raw data in the table above. From the above we see that there are 8 (-)ve signs, 6 (+)ve sings and 1 zero. As per the convention we drop the pair giving rise to zero. Then and as the (+)ve sing is less frequent. Calculating the value of K we have:
Since the null hypothesis is accepted and we may conclude that there is no significant difference in the number of days between an accounts receivable before and after the introduction of a new policy.
